Draper is an independent, nonprofit research and development company headquartered in Cambridge, MA. The 2,000+ employees of Draper tackle important national challenges with a promise of delivering successful and usable solutions. From military defense and space exploration to biomedical engineering, lives often depend on the solutions we provide. Our multidisciplinary teams of engineers and scientists work in a collaborative environment that inspires the cross-fertilization of ideas necessary for true innovation. The Autonomy & Real-Time Planning Group is seeking an undergraduate student to support current programs developing autonomy solutions for the air, ground, and undersea domains. In this role, the student will be responsible for supporting development needs of our sponsors as part of a multidisciplinary team. Duties may include analysis, algorithm development, and software development for autonomy applications.
